Hidden Charm, January 23-March 7

Blackbird Café, in downtown Valparaiso, offers more than just great food and quality coffees and teas. They also focus on the creativity this town has to offer, by featuring live music and artists. For a two month run, an artist can exhibit his or her work on the walls of the café, a display that is kicked off with an opening reception. This past Saturday, January 23, Blackbird hosted a reception for Eleanor Schreiner.

Eleanor’s show is entitled “Hidden Charm.” Her work displays a story of emotions and thoughts about a time spent overseas, experiencing another culture. The art consists of mainly self portraits, graphically arranged in a clever and witty manner. She also has some portraits of people she encountered on her trip.

The show was well attended, with many from the community coming out to view the work. Live music was provided by Eleanor’s parents, her dad Paul on guitar. Free refreshments were enjoyed by all. The show will be up through March 7, for those who were unable to stop by during the opening.

Blackbird Café is located at 114 E Lincolnway.
